History of the Catholic lay movement founded in Milwaukee to unite the sufferings and prayers of the sick with the saving work of Christ. Foreword by Most Rev. Aloisius J. Muench, D.D., L.L.D. (then Bishop of Fargo). Nihil obstat by H. B. Ries and imprimatur by Archbishop Samuel A. Stritch dated March 8, 1939. Preface dated Feast of the Most Sacred Heart of Jesus, June 24, 1938. Includes the acrostic poem The Apostleship of the Sick and a chapter on St. Lidwina of Schiedam. This copy is inscribed and signed by Clara M. Tiry on her portrait leaf, reading: "In your prayers to Jesus please remember The Author, Clara M. Tiry". Her name also appears in ink on the half title. Uncommon in commerce, especially signed. First edition; no later printings located in standard bibliographies.
